Special Guest: Louise Tucker Jones
Louise Tucker Jones is a vibrant speaker and true storyteller. She will touch your heart with her poignant life stories and tickle your funny bone with her unique humor. An award-winning author/co-author of three books, Louise’s work has been featured in numerous publications, including Guideposts, Focus on the Family, and several Chicken Soup for the Soul titles. She also writes an inspiring monthly column for the Edmond Outlook Magazine.
